mobile_width=\u00a0\u00bb0&Prime; width=\u00a0\u00bb1\/1&Prime; uncode_shortcode_id=\u00a0\u00bb711417&Prime;][vc_column_text uncode_shortcode_id=\u00a0\u00bb120693&Prime;]<\/p>\n<p class=\"font-claude-response-body break-words whitespace-normal\">Afin de d\u00e9terminer si le reconditionnement influe sur la pr\u00e9cision de la quantification des prot\u00e9ines, nous avons r\u00e9alis\u00e9 le test BCA de Pierce selon deux m\u00e9thodes : une m\u00e9thode sur microplaque (plaques en polystyr\u00e8ne \u00e0 96 puits) et une m\u00e9thode sur tube (tubes de microcentrifugation en polypropyl\u00e8ne de 1,5 ml).<\/p>\n<p class=\"font-claude-response-body break-words whitespace-normal\">Trois microplaques et 18 tubes ont \u00e9t\u00e9 soumis \u00e0 cinq cycles de reconditionnement et r\u00e9utilis\u00e9s pour r\u00e9aliser le dosage apr\u00e8s chaque cycle, en comparaison avec des consommables neufs \u00e0 chaque cycle. Les deux formats ont suivi <a href=\"https:\/\/www.thermofisher.com\/document-connect\/document-connect.html?url=https:\/\/assets.thermofisher.com\/TFS-Assets%2FLSG%2Fmanuals%2FMAN0011430_Pierce_BCA_Protein_Asy_UG.pdf\">les protocoles<\/a> BCA standard, avec 9 \u00e9talons de concentration et un blanc \u00e0 l&rsquo;eau Milli-Q dans chaque condition. L\u2019absorbance a \u00e9t\u00e9 mesur\u00e9e \u00e0 562 nm, et des courbes d\u2019\u00e9talonnage ont \u00e9t\u00e9 \u00e9tablies pour chaque condition. Pour les tubes, les valeurs de R\u00b2 sont rest\u00e9es syst\u00e9matiquement sup\u00e9rieures \u00e0 0.99, tant pour les tubes neufs que pour les tubes reconditionn\u00e9s, et aucune diff\u00e9rence statistiquement significative n&rsquo;a \u00e9t\u00e9 d\u00e9tect\u00e9e au niveau de l&rsquo;absorbance pour aucun des \u00e9talons. L\u2019absorbance \u00e0 blanc des tubes reconditionn\u00e9s \u00e9tait l\u00e9g\u00e8rement sup\u00e9rieure \u00e0 celle des tubes neufs (d\u2019environ 0.003 unit\u00e9 d\u2019absorbance), mais cette diff\u00e9rence n\u2019\u00e9tait pas statistiquement significative.
